East Rutherford: FIFA has launched an investigation into an on-field altercation between players of Argentina and Spain following Spain’s victory in the FIFA World Cup final.
The incident occurred during Spain’s post-match celebrations, which briefly turned chaotic after players from both teams became involved in a confrontation.
Video footage of the clash showed several players exchanging pushes, with Argentina midfielder Leandro Paredes appearing to grab Spain defender Eric Garcia by the throat. Spain substitute Gavi stepped in to intervene but was reportedly pushed to the ground by Paredes.
FIFA confirmed that it has opened disciplinary proceedings to examine the incident and determine whether any players will face sanctions. Further action will depend on the findings of the investigation.
